4/13/2026 – The River’s Edge


Finnley Reed ran as fast as he could out the gates of Farthwell, his hometown now set ablaze by an unknown raiding party. His path led toward the river’s edge, where the townsfolk gathered fresh water. His only hope was that his family had made it there.

What does Finny find at the river?

On a 1: He finds no one.

On a 2: He finds his father.

On a 3: He finds his older brother.

On a 4-6: He finds his younger sister.

Finnley rolled a 2.

As he approached the river, he saw a small group of soot-covered survivors, their faces beaten down with grief. He scanned them quickly until his eyes landed on a familiar face. His father.

With a sigh of relief, Finny ran forward and wrapped his arms around him. His father’s grief-stricken face lit up at the sight of his son.

Session 2 – Finnley reunites with his father at the river’s edge. The village still burns behind them. A heavy, emotional moment in the chaos.

Finnley and his Father at the river’s edge. The village of Farthwell burning in the background.

Thank the heavens!” his father exclaimed. “Finnley… they took your mother and sister. To where, I do not know. The locals are saying the raiders went…”

Where did the raiders go?

On a 1-2: They went north.

On a 3-4: They went east into the mountains.

On a 5-6: They headed south.

The roll was a 5.

The raiders were seen heading south with their spoils and newly caught slaves.

What about Mitchel? Where’s my brother?” Finnley asked, his voice desperate.

Mitchel… he stood and fought the raiders and was killed. I tried to help, but by the time I got close enough he was already bleeding out. There was nothing I could do… so I headed toward the river with the other survivors,” his father explained.

Finnley’s head sank. His eyes filled with tears as the news struck his heart. His brother dead. His mother and little sister taken by raiders. His father alive, but riddled with grief.

What does Finny do next?

On a 1-3: Finnley decides to follow the raiders south. Alone.

On a 4-5: He heads back to the village to gather supplies.

On a 6: His father joins him in the quest.

Finnley rolled a 1.

Stubborn as always, Finny told his father to stay behind and help the remaining villagers. With only his trusty oak staff, the clothes on his back, and a waterskin of fresh river water, Finnley set off south toward the Broken Coast.
